What You’ll Do:

The Mechanical Engineer is responsible for leading the design and the development of connected pet care products, utilizing CAD software to create mechanical designs and will be a part of a team exploring developing concepts through prototyping and into mass-production consumer electronics. The Senior Mechanical Engineer will work as part of a cross-functional team requiring collaboration and curiosity in domains other than mechanical engineering and will utilize strong mechanical engineering fundamentals, prototyping skills, CAD fluency, manufacturing process knowledge, and experience designing consumer electronics.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

This list of duties and responsibilities is not all-inclusive and may be expanded to include other duties and responsibilities as deemed necessary.

  • Actively participates in the mechanical engineering team in the design and development of innovative products, coordinating efforts to meet project timelines, quality standards and cost objectives
  • Utilizes Creo CAD software to develop plastic injection molded parts as well as complex mechanical designs ensuring precision, functionality and adherence to project specifications
  • Continuously evaluates and optimizes mechanical designs for efficiency, manufacturability, and cost-effectiveness, leveraging own expertise in materials, manufacturing processes and design best practices along with the knowledge of tooling engineers and suppliers
  • Develops and maintains comprehensive documentation, including design specifications, technical drawings and engineering documentation
  • Demonstrates systems-thinking mentality to understand how other engineering disciplines integrate together to achieve product requirements
  • Conducts benchmarking research and creates design proposals for projects

Requirements

What You’ll Bring:

  • BS in Mechanical Engineering
  • 5 years of industry experience in mechanical design
  • Experience in Design for Manufacturability (DFM), Design for Assembly (DFA), statistical tolerance analysis techniques, GD&T, and 3D/2D CAD (Creo, NX, Solidworks)
  • Working knowledge in material properties, such as plastics, metal, adhesive, etc.
  • Testing and analysis experience (FEA, Simulation, Design of Experiments, etc.)
  • Knowledge of high-volume manufacturing techniques (stamping, machining, injection molding, etc.)
  • Comfortable with office pets (cats, dogs)
  • Maintains confidentiality of proprietary information
  • Ability to maintain a professional atmosphere in a fast-paced environment with numerous interactions and interruptions
  • A high degree of initiative, self-motivation, and ability to motivate others
  • Ability to establish and maintain cooperative working relationships with Team Members and colleagues

Not Required but nice to have:

  • 8 years of consumer product design experience, including full systems ownership.
  • 3 years of experience using Creo CAD for design of consumer products.
  • Experience with system integration, including electro-mechanical components (e.g., audio, display, camera, antenna), waterproofing, thermals, grounding, or product architecture
  • Experience collaborating with suppliers around the world on part manufacturing and final assembly, including onsite factory support
  • Experience shipping multiple consumer products in an engineering role.
